Jägermeister reveals Ice Cold Wrap competition
By Melita KielyHerbal liqueur brand Jägermeister has released a limited edition bottle featuring a competition that can only be accessed once the bottle has been chilled down to -15 degrees Celsius.
The bottle must be chilled to reveal the competition codeDesigned to highlight the brand’s ‘ice-cold’ message, once chilled to the optimum temperature, a unique code will be revealed on the packaging.
This will then lead customers to the Jägermeister e-shop, where they will be able to win an array of prizes, such as up to £20 off a Jagershop (including free delivery) or an exclusive single bottle tap machine. Every bottle has a prize.
The bottle is available exclusively at Morrisons supermarket stores across the UK at a “discounted price” of £16 per 700ml bottle.
A total of 20,000 limited edition bottles have been released and the competition will run until the end of May next year.
Giles Mountford, category manager, said: “Jägermeister wants to encourage fans to enjoy the product the way it should be consumed, ice-cold.
“Not only is it one of the first drinks brands to create this unique packaging, but the bottle has to get down to a staggering -10 to -15 degrees to change the thermochromic inks, which is much colder than average.”
